Outcomes of deep brain stimulation surgery in the management of dystonia in glutaric aciduria type 1.

Alternative Title

Abstract

Objectives: Glutaric aciduria type 1 (GA1) is a rare autosomal recessive organic acidaemia caused by deficiency of the glutaryl-CoA dehydrogenase enzyme. We describe the outcomes following deep brain stimulation (DBS) for the management of dystonia of children and adults with glutaric aciduria type 1 (GA1).
